PURPOSE: A piezoresistive composite and a manufacturing method thereof are provided to prevent the deformation of a conductive particle due to repetitive use by obtaining high hardness.;CONSTITUTION: A piezoresistive composite includes a conductive ceramic particle of 35-70% based on a polymer ectromelus. The polymer ectromelus has high insulation resistance and elasticity and is made of one or mixture selected from silicon rubber, polyurethanes, low density polyethylene, and high density polyethylene. The conductive ceramic particle is a compound including group III to VIII transition metal on a periodic table.;COPYRIGHT KIPO 2010
